The government policies related to the Algeria Filtered Connectors Market primarily focus on promoting local production and reducing dependency on imports. Algeria has implemented import restrictions and tariffs to encourage domestic manufacturing of electronic components, including filtered connectors. The government provides support and incentives to local manufacturers to boost production capacity and enhance technology capabilities in the sector. Additionally, there are regulations in place to ensure product quality and compliance with international standards to compete in the global market. Overall, the government`s policies aim to stimulate growth in the domestic filtered connectors market, create job opportunities, and strengthen the country`s industrial sector.
